Dr. Wanpeng Li is a Lecturer in Cyber Security within the Department of Computer Science at the University of Liverpool. Prior to this role, he held lecturer positions at the University of Aberdeen and Manchester Metropolitan University, and worked as a postdoctoral researcher at City, University of London. His research focuses on critical areas in cyber security including web security, identity management, authentication mechanisms, and malware detection using machine learning. Research Trends: His recent publications span both cyber security and mathematical modeling domains. Key security themes include automated vulnerability detection, federated learning attacks, and privacy-preserving protocols for vehicular networks and IIoT systems. Parallel studies in grey system models explore energy consumption forecasting and environmental impact analysis using fractional calculus and neural network integrations. Advising: Dr. Li actively accepts PhD students in cyber security-related fields.
